Which office holds Offenbach am Main birth certificates
- Responsible office: Standesamt Offenbach am Main
- Older records held at: Stadtarchiv Offenbach am Main
- State / region: Hessen
- Civil registration from: 1876 (empire-wide)
- Public access: a birth certificate becomes public after 110 years
What a Offenbach am Main birth certificate shows
The birth register (Geburtsregister) records the child’s full name, the exact date, time and place of birth, and both parents — the father’s occupation and the mother’s maiden name. It is often more complete than the equivalent church record.
Why it matters for German citizenship
Descent claims (StAG §5, Article 116(2) and ordinary jus sanguinis) turn on an unbroken documented line. A certified Offenbach am Main birth certificate is core evidence of that line.
